SQL Server: Datenbankentwicklung

12 Monate
Trainings-ID:
SQLPP

Inhalt des Trainings

Dieses Training wird auf Basis der aktuellsten SQL Version dabgehalten.
Der überwiegende Anteil der erworbenen Kenntnisse ist abwärtskompatibel (bis inkl. SQL Server 2008). 

Ausgenommen sind neu hinzugekommene, versionsspezifische Features, auf die im Rahmen des Kurses hingewiesen wird.

Nach Abschluss des Trainings haben die Teilnehmer*innen Kenntnisse zu folgenden Themen:
  • Tabellen entwerfen und erstellen
  • Partitionierung, Temporale Tabellen, Datenkompression
  • Deklarative Datenintegrität
  • Indizierung, Optimierung, Ausführungspläne
  • Query Store, Database Engine Tuning Advisor
  • Columnstore Indizes
  • Views entwerfen und erstellen
  • Stored Procedures entwerfen und erstellen
  • User-Defined Functions entwerfen und erstellen
  • Mit Triggers auf Datenmanipulation reagieren
  • In-Memory Tabellen
  • Verwendung von Managed Code (.net) in SQL Server
  • XML-Daten in SQL Server ablegen und abfragen
  • Arbeiten mit SQL Server Spatial Data
  • Blobs und Dokumente in SQL Server ablegen und abfragen

 

Zielgruppen

  • angehende und erfahrene Datenbankentwickler*innen, die mehr aus den Möglichkeiten machen wollen, die SQL Server als Entwicklungsplattform anbietet.

Vorkenntnisse

  • SQLAP smart SQL Server: Data Querying mit Transact-SQL oder adäquate Kenntisse werden empfohlen.

Detail-Inhalte

Einführung in Datenbankentwicklung
  • Einführung in die SQL Server Plattform
  • Aufgaben und Tools
Tabellen entwerfen und erstellen
  • Entwerfen von Tabellen
  • SQL Server Datentypen
  • Schemas
  • Erstellen und Modifizieren von Tabellen
Fortgeschrittener Tabellen-Entwurf
  • Partitionierung
  • Datenkomprimierung
  • Temporale Tabellen
Deklarative Datenintegrität
  • Überblick über Datenintegrität
  • Domänenintegrität
  • Entitätsintegrität und referenzielle Integrität
Indizes
  • Kernkonzepte
  • Datentypen und Indizierung
  • Ein- und mehrspaltige Indizes
Optimierung der Indizierung
  • „Covering“ Indizes
  • Verwalten von Indizes
  • Ausführungspläne
  • Database Engine Tuning Advisor
  • Query Store
Columnstore Indizes
  • Erstellen von Columnstore Indizes
  • Arbeiten mit Columnstore Indizes
Views entwerfen und erstellen
  • Erstellen und Verwalten von Views
  • Leisitungsaspekte
Stored Procedures entwerfen und erstellen
  • Arbeiten mit Stored Procedures
  • Parametrisierung
  • Ausführungskontext
User-Defined Functions entwerfen und erstellen
  • Skalare Funktionen
  • Tabellenwertige Funktionen
  • Besondere Aspekte und Alternativen zu Funktionen
Mit Triggers auf Datenmanipulation reagieren
  • DML Triggers
  • Verschachtelte und rekursive Triggers
In-Memory Tabellen
  • Memory Optimized Tabellen
  • Native Stored Procedures
Verwendung von Managed Code (.net) in SQL Server
  • SQL Server .net Integration
  • Import und Konfiguration von Assemblies
  • Verwendung von Managed Code
XML-Daten in SQL Server ablegen und abfragen
  • Einführung in XML und XML Schemas
  • XML datentyp in SQL Server
  • Das FOR XML Statement
  • Einführung in xQuery
Arbeiten mit SQL Server Spatial Data
  • Einführung in „Spatial“
  • GEOMETRY und GEOGRAPHY Datentypen verwenden
  • „Spatial“ Daten abfragen
Blobs und Dokumente in SQL Server ablegen und abfragen
  • Überblick über BLOB-Daten
  • FileStream
  • SQL Server Volltextsuche

Trainings zur Vorbereitung

Downloads

Jetzt online buchen

  • 22.04.-25.04.2024 22.04.2024 4T 4 Tage Wien Online
    ETC-Wien · Modecenterstraße 22, Office 4, 5. Stock, 1030 Wien Uhrzeiten
    • Preis  2.390,-
      • Präsenz
      • Online
  • 22.04.-25.04.2024 22.04.2024 4T 4 Tage Graz Online
    ETC-Graz · Kärntner Straße 311, 8054 Graz Uhrzeiten
    • Preis  2.390,-
      • Präsenz
      • Online
  • 15.07.-18.07.2024 15.07.2024 4T 4 Tage Wien Online
    ETC-Wien · Modecenterstraße 22, Office 4, 5. Stock, 1030 Wien Uhrzeiten
    • Preis  2.390,-
      • Präsenz
      • Online
  • 15.07.-18.07.2024 15.07.2024 4T 4 Tage Graz Online
    ETC-Graz · Kärntner Straße 311, 8054 Graz Uhrzeiten
    • Preis  2.390,-
      • Präsenz
      • Online
  • 14.10.-17.10.2024 14.10.2024 4T 4 Tage Wien Online
    ETC-Wien · Modecenterstraße 22, Office 4, 5. Stock, 1030 Wien Uhrzeiten
    • Preis  2.390,-
      • Präsenz
      • Online
  • 14.10.-17.10.2024 14.10.2024 4T 4 Tage Graz Online
    ETC-Graz · Kärntner Straße 311, 8054 Graz Uhrzeiten
    • Preis  2.390,-
      • Präsenz
      • Online

Preise exkl. MwSt.

Sie haben Fragen?

Ihr ETC Support

Kontaktieren Sie uns!

+43 1 533 1777-99

Hidden
Hidden
Hidden
4,9

20 Bewertungen

  • 09.01.2024

    Der Kurs hat unsere bisherigen SQL-Kurse zur Administration und zum Querying sehr gut ergänzt!

    — Julian H.

    SQL Server: Datenbankentwicklung

    09.01.2024

    Der Kurs hat unsere bisherigen SQL-Kurse zur Administration und zum Querying sehr gut ergänzt!

    — Julian H.
  • 19.10.2023

    Toller Kurs, der einen guten Überblick über MS SQL Server und jeder Menge nützliche Infos darüber gibt.

    — Alexander P.

    SQL Server: Datenbankentwicklung

    19.10.2023

    Toller Kurs, der einen guten Überblick über MS SQL Server und jeder Menge nützliche Infos darüber gibt.

    — Alexander P.
  • 30.03.2020

    Der Trainer ist sowohl fachlich als auch technisch sehr kompetent. Der Stoff wurde sehr anschaulich und verständlich übermittelt.

    — Adele B.

    SQL Server: Datenbankentwicklung

    30.03.2020

    Der Trainer ist sowohl fachlich als auch technisch sehr kompetent. Der Stoff wurde sehr anschaulich und verständlich übermittelt.

    — Adele B.
  • 21.11.2019

    Stoff etwas zu umfangreich für 4 Tage.

    — Daniel P.

    SQL Server: Datenbankentwicklung

    21.11.2019

    Stoff etwas zu umfangreich für 4 Tage.

    — Daniel P.
  • 14.02.2019

    Der Trainer ist technisch, wie auch menschlich kompetent. Endlich wieder was gelernt.

    — Robert K.

    SQL Server: Datenbankentwicklung

    14.02.2019

    Der Trainer ist technisch, wie auch menschlich kompetent. Endlich wieder was gelernt.

    — Robert K.
  • 07.12.2017

    Alles Bestens. Gute Erklärungen.

    — Gerald G.

    SQL Server: Datenbankentwicklung

    07.12.2017

    Alles Bestens. Gute Erklärungen.

    — Gerald G.
  • 12.07.2017

    Kompetenter Trainer

    — Thomas H.

    SQL Server: Datenbankentwicklung

    12.07.2017

    Kompetenter Trainer

    — Thomas H.
  • 12.07.2017

    Sehr guter Kurs, jede darüber hinausgehende Frage wurde ausführlich beantwortet.

    — Herbert R.

    SQL Server: Datenbankentwicklung

    12.07.2017

    Sehr guter Kurs, jede darüber hinausgehende Frage wurde ausführlich beantwortet.

    — Herbert R.
  • 30.06.2017

    Sehr guter parxisnaher Kurs. Kompetenter Trainer.

    — Christoph W.

    SQL Server: Datenbankentwicklung

    30.06.2017

    Sehr guter parxisnaher Kurs. Kompetenter Trainer.

    — Christoph W.
  • 22.03.2017

    Wie immer sehr gut mit Wissen aus der Praxis des Trainers aufgepeppter Microsoft-Kurs

    — Daniel H.

    SQL Server: Datenbankentwicklung

    22.03.2017

    Wie immer sehr gut mit Wissen aus der Praxis des Trainers aufgepeppter Microsoft-Kurs

    — Daniel H.
  • 01.12.2016

    Sehr guter Überblick über die in der Inhaltsangabe erwähnten Themen, Kursleiter sehr kompetent und praxisnah. Andreas S.

    — Andreas S.

    SQL Server: Datenbankentwicklung

    01.12.2016

    Sehr guter Überblick über die in der Inhaltsangabe erwähnten Themen, Kursleiter sehr kompetent und praxisnah. Andreas S.

    — Andreas S.
  • 28.04.2016

    Informativ und praxisnah, ausgezeichnete Tranerin

    — Hermann W.

    SQL Server: Datenbankentwicklung

    28.04.2016

    Informativ und praxisnah, ausgezeichnete Tranerin

    — Hermann W.
  • 08.04.2016

    Super Kurs. Sehr viele Hintergrundinfos zu den Themen. Super kompetente Trainerin.

    — Gerhard R.

    SQL Server: Datenbankentwicklung

    08.04.2016

    Super Kurs. Sehr viele Hintergrundinfos zu den Themen. Super kompetente Trainerin.

    — Gerhard R.
  • 05.07.2013

    Sehr viele gut Beispiele. Wird jetzt noch als Nachschlagewerk genommen. Wissen des Vortragenden TOP.

    — Christian P.

    SQL Server: Datenbankentwicklung

    05.07.2013

    Sehr viele gut Beispiele. Wird jetzt noch als Nachschlagewerk genommen. Wissen des Vortragenden TOP.

    — Christian P.
  • 06.12.2012

    viel gelernt

    — Daniela G.

    SQL Server: Datenbankentwicklung

    06.12.2012

    viel gelernt

    — Daniela G.
  • 05.06.2012

    Ein echt tolles Seminar

    — Christoph K.

    SQL Server: Datenbankentwicklung

    05.06.2012

    Ein echt tolles Seminar

    — Christoph K.
  • 31.05.2012

    Super!

    — Manuel U.

    SQL Server: Datenbankentwicklung

    31.05.2012

    Super!

    — Manuel U.

Unsere Empfehlungen für Sie

SQL Server: Data Querying mit Transact-SQL

SQL Server leicht gemacht mit Hands-on-Training

29.04.2024+6
 1.390,-
15.04.2024+2
 1.785,-

Lernformen im Überblick

Mehr darüber